Italy - Hospital Discharges for Conduction Disorders and Cardiac Arrhythmias

Since 2014, Italy Hospital Discharges for Conduction Disorders and Cardiac Arrhythmias fell by 1.9% year on year. In 2019, the country was ranked number 6 among other countries in Hospital Discharges for Conduction Disorders and Cardiac Arrhythmias at 123,948 Hospital Discharges. Italy is overtaken by United Kingdom, which was ranked number 5 at 133,491 Hospital Discharges and is followed by Spain at 81,317 Hospital Discharges. Germany topped the ranking with 476,335 Hospital Discharges in 2019, +1.7% versus 2018. Japan, France and Poland resp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. South Korea recorded the best 5 years average growth at +5.2% per year, while Portugal recorded the worst performance at -3.4% per year.
